Abstract :
At the beginning of the 21st century, 1 Gb DRAMs will be in practical use, and sufficient in terms of memory capacity for most memory application systems. The key technologies for multimedia systems include data compression, communication, storage, and human interfaces. Image data processing, ATM switch, and microprocessor in multimedia applications require the high data transfer rate from several 100 Mbits/s to Tbits/s. Storage systems, on the other hand, require the reduction of the price per bit to less than 10 cents/Mbytes. Application specific design approaches towards a system-on-chip are strongly needed for ULSI memories in the multimedia era
